Battle for first
Last night, the South Oxford 3E Power U18 Storm played their final round robin playoff game in St. Mary's against the Rock.

Last nights game would determine first place and second place as both teams head into the semi finals in the Shamrock league.

In the first period, both teams were trying to get the all important first goal of the game and unfortunately that went to the Rock. The boys tried to even the score and had plenty of chances but had nothing to show for it.

In the middle frame, with the boys down one, they were working hard but the netminder was up to the task. The score remained 1-0 as the period came to an end.

In the final frame, the boys tried hard but St. Mary's went into shut down mode and didn't allow the boys to even the score. The final score was 1-0.

With the loss, the boys ended up in second place and look to play the St. Thomas Jr. Stars in the semifinals. The series will not start until March 15th at the earliest. Please keep an eye on the updated calendar for the schedule.
